200–700Central America [statistics and demography]The Zapotec site of Monte Albán in Central America is at its peak in this period. It may have had 30,000 or more inhabitants. It is the centre of a complex of public buildings, temples, and dwellings that cover 40 sq km/15 sq mi.
255–265China [wars]Peace and unity are finally restored in China with the victories of the Wei Kingdom in the north. The ruling dynasty is worn out by war, and the kingdom is ruled by ministers on their behalf – the Ssu-mas. During the next decade, Ssu-ma Chao conquers the western kingdom of Shu Han.
265China [political events]The ruling minister of the northern Chinese kingdom of Wei, Ssu-ma Chao, dies, and his son Ssu-ma Yen usurps the throne from the royal family, becoming known as the emperor Wudi, and founding the Western Chin dynasty. For the next 50 years the northern kingdom exerts some suzerainty over the other kingdoms.
